When Hormones Enter a Wellness Conversation

Persistent fatigue, disrupted sleep, mood changes, low energy, changes in body composition, and menopausal symptoms often prompt clients to ask about hormones. These signals may be hormone-related, but they may also reflect other issues — which is why lab testing and physician review come first.

HRT and Bioidentical Hormone Replacement in Thailand

HRT in Thailand and bioidentical hormone replacement in Thailand are both prescribed under medical supervision. A responsible clinic will review your labs, symptoms, personal history, and family history before considering either.

There is no universally best protocol. Dosing, delivery form, and follow-up are individualized.

Why Physician Supervision Is Non-Negotiable

Hormones influence multiple systems. Ongoing monitoring, dose adjustment, and periodic re-testing are essential parts of any program. A concierge helps coordinate follow-up around your schedule while the medical decisions remain with your physician.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is HRT in Thailand suitable for everyone with fatigue or low energy?

No. Symptoms like fatigue can have many causes. A physician reviews your labs and history before considering whether HRT or bioidentical hormone replacement is appropriate.

Can I combine hormone therapy with other regenerative programs?

Sometimes, under medical supervision. Whether combinations are appropriate depends on your assessment, not on marketing packages.

How is follow-up structured for hormone programs?

Follow-up typically includes periodic re-testing and physician review. A concierge can coordinate scheduling around your travel and lifestyle.
